[UPDATE] Battle Royale: The Complete Collection will be released on blu-ray in the U.S. on March 20th. This special edition will contain 4 discs featuring the theatrical and director’s cuts of ‘Battle Royale’, the
theatricaldirector’s cut of ‘Battle Royale II’, and a DVD copy of the director’s cut of the first film.Over 2 hours of special features will be included:
- The Making Of Battle Royale featurette
- Battle Royale press conference
- Instructional video: “Birthday Version”
- Audition/rehearsal footage
- Special effects comparison featurette
- Footage from the 2000 Tokyo International Film Festival
- Battle Royale documentary
- “Basketball Scene” rehearsals
- Behind-the-scenes featurette
- Filming on-set footage
- Original theatrical trailer
- Special Edition TV spot
- TV spot: “Tarantino Version”- -

For those who are unfamiliar with the now Japenese cult phenomenon, here is a quick description:
With school children all over the country growing increasingly delinquent, the Japanese government takes decisive action and introduces the Battle Royale Act. The Act sets forth a plan whereby a class will be chosen at random and flown to a remote island, where each student will then be given a weapon and set loose to fight their classmates, each student knowing that only one of their number will be allowed to leave the island alive. When Class B of Zentsuji Middle School are chosen to take part in the massacre, the different students quickly take sides against each other, but Shuya and Noriko form an alliance and try to weather it through together. Considering ‘Battle Royale’ first came out in 2000, the movie has taken way too long to get a U.S. release. Even so, I am glad U.S. audiences can now appreciate this masterpiece in high definition and with proper subtitles. I had bought a DVD edition off Ebay years back that had decent picture but was translated poorly in some scenes. I’m not sure what took so long for a U.S. release, but my best guess as to why its being released now is because of the similarities it has with the upcoming ‘Hunger Games’ being released in theaters March 23rd, 3 days after the blu-ray release of ‘Battle Royale’.
In addition to the complete collection available March 20th, distributor Anchor Bay will also release a single disc addition of the first film.
